AGRIDA Saperavi offers a deep dive into Georgia's rich wine heritage with its robust, full-bodied reds that showcase the grape's characteristic dark fruit and strong structure. As one of Georgia's most important teinturier varieties, this wine is a testament to the country’s ancient winemaking traditions, known for producing deeply colored, structured, and long-lived wines. Expect flavors of blackberry, black cherry, plum, and pomegranate, complemented by notes of smoke, earth, spice, and sometimes a tangy sour-cherry note. The wine's balance between acidity and tannin makes it both refreshing and age-worthy, ideal for pairing with grilled meats, cheese dishes, and savory stews.
